ST. REGIS, MONTANA

After spending last night in Grand Forks, about sixteen kms from the US border, we crossed this morning.  We had a very pleasant lady who came aboard and inspected us.  She wished us a pleasant winter in AZ.
Today we made it to St. Regis, Montana driving through some heavy rain with even a bit of sleet mixed in.  The GPS took us a new way through Spokane and it was much better than the old way of driving through downtown Spokane.    It brought us out several miles east of the old route.  209 miles yesterday and 254 today so staying pretty close to my 250 mile target per day.  The plan is Dillon, MT tomorrow then Springville, UT the next and Grand Junction the final day.
